Analysis
In 2025, employment to population ratio, ages 15-24, total (%) in IDA blend stood at 45.2%.
Compared with earlier readings it is down 0.2% on the previous year and down 2.5% over ten years.
Over the whole period, employment to population ratio, ages 15-24, total (%) in IDA blend peaked at 55.3% in 1992 and was at its lowest, 42.3%, in 2020.
IDA blend ranks 11th of 47 groups on this measure, in the top qu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 35 years of available data.
